Moira McCann is a scholar working on Hematology, Pulmonary and Respiratory Medicine and Immunology. According to data from OpenAlex, Moira McCann has authored 19 papers receiving a total of 732 indexed citations (citations by other indexed papers that have themselves been cited), including 8 papers in Hematology, 6 papers in Pulmonary and Respiratory Medicine and 4 papers in Immunology. Recurrent topics in Moira McCann's work include Aortic aneurysm repair treatments (6 papers), Blood groups and transfusion (5 papers) and Platelet Disorders and Treatments (4 papers). Moira McCann is often cited by papers focused on Aortic aneurysm repair treatments (6 papers), Blood groups and transfusion (5 papers) and Platelet Disorders and Treatments (4 papers). Moira McCann collaborates with scholars based in United Kingdom and Australia. Moira McCann's co-authors include Jonathan Golledge, Mirko Karan, Paul E. Norman, Simone Mangan, Alfred K. Lam, Petra Büttner, Adam Parr, Corey S. Moran, Natkunam Ketheesan and Barbara Bradshaw and has published in prestigious journals such as Circulation, Stroke and European Heart Journal.
